Mary Lofton Obituary

Mary Jane Perry Lofton, 82, of Crossett, passed away on Friday, December 31, 2021, peacefully at her home.  She was born on November 27, 1939,to her parents, James Walter and Eula Orene Hicks Perry in Ashley County, Arkansas.

In 1957, Mary graduated from Drew Central High School and then moved to Morgan City, LA to start a career as a telephone operator. There she was introduced to her future husband, Lawrence Clay Lofton Sr., and they were married in Reno, NV on August 30, 1958. She  spent the next few years of her life, raising a military family, and traveling the world as a Navy wife.  

After Lawrence retired from the military in 1976, they moved to Crossett and made it their home.   Mary worked for Altel Telephone Company as a local operator for many years, and then later graduated from Forrest Echoes in 1994 as an L.P.N.

She enjoyed sewing and making quilt tops for family and friends, but especially loved spending time with her family.  She will be forever missed by all who knew her.
